Frequently Asked Questions

We’ll reach out before your event to check logistics — where our truck and trailer can park, and a safe space to unload the donkeys. We arrive at least 30 minutes early to make sure the donkeys are clean, tacked up, and your drinks or party favors are loaded on time. We ask that there are no loose dogs on the property, as the donkeys are not dog friendly. Once Banjo and Fiddle are out carrying your drinks, enjoy the time with them and your guests!

No — we provide the service to carry them! Drinks, party favors, chips, candy… whatever you’d like to offer your guests. We recommend having the drinks chilled and set aside 30 minutes before our appointment time. The pack boxes are foam-lined to keep drinks from rolling or breaking, and we can include ice packs to keep everything cool. Jelly jars with lids work great for cocktails!

Not at all — we pick up all the donkey poop and take it home with us! We also plan to get bum-bags for the donkeys soon, so there’ll be no mess at all from Banjo and Fiddle.

Yes! We bring donkey-safe treats for your guests to feed them. We just ask that guests only feed the provided treats, since the donkeys can get sick from foods that aren’t safe for them.

We serve the greater Spokane, WA area and travel to your venue. A travel fee of $2.00 per mile applies.

Banjo and Fiddle are people-oriented, calm, and gentle, and they’re accompanied by their handlers at all times. Guests of all ages are welcome to pet them, take photos, and feed them the treats we provide.

Absolutely — the donkeys are happy to wear colors or decorations that match the theme of your event. Let us know what you’re planning when you book!

Three things make event day smooth: parking space for our truck and trailer with a safe area to unload, drinks chilled and set aside 30 minutes before our arrival, and no loose dogs on the property.
